ive got a 99 ranger with a 3 inch Body lift and ive got 31 11.50's.........but i just bought the 3 inch spindles from fabtech for a little under 700$ so i can clear my new 33 12.50's ...........so if u can afford it do both if not do the body lift....about 100 bucks.....me and a buddy did mine in about 7 hours .............and u can prob clear 32's
Body life is blocks that go between the frame and body.
Spindles are part of the front end were your a arms mount and steering rods.
